Public policy foundation administrator
Scanlon, Terrence Maurice was born on May 1, 1939 in Milwaukee. Son of Maurice John and Anne (Hayes) Scanlon.
Bachelor of Science, Villanova University, 1961.
Staff assistant, The White House, Washington, 1963-1967; with, Small Business Administration, Washington, 1967-1969; with, Department of Commerce, Washington, 1969-1983; member office Minority Business Enterprise, Department of Commerce, Washington, 1969-1980; with International Trade Administration, Department of Commerce, Washington, 1980-1981; with Minority Business Development Agency, Department of Commerce, Washington, 1981-1983; member, Consumer Product Safety Commission, Washington, 1983-1989; vice chairman, Consumer Product Safety Commission, Washington, 1983-1984; chairman, Consumer Product Safety Commission, Washington, 1985, 86-89; vice president, treasurer, The Heritage Foundation, Washington, 1989-1991; vice president corporation relations, The Heritage Foundation, Washington, 1991-1994; chairman, president, Capital Research Center, Washington, since 1994.
Member Sovereign Military Order of Malta, University Club.
Married Judy Ball, June 14, 1969. Children: Michael Mansfield, Justin Ball, Brendan Hayes.
